Bucket(分桶)数量设置不当带来的问题问题描述:上线运行一段时间后,随着越来越多的数据增长,集群每次重启后一周左右,读写就会开始变得越来越慢,直到无法正常进行读写。问题处理:对数仓表的Schema的分析,发现有些表数据并不大,但是Bucket却设置的非常大通过showdatafromtable命令列出所有表Bucket信息,大部分的Bucket设置不合理按照官方的建议将调整Bucket设置,调整后集群逐步恢复正常的读写关于Partition和Bucket的数量和数据量的建议一个表的Tablet总数量等于(Partitionnum*Bucketnum)数量原则:一个表的Tablet数量,在不
1、问题来源操作minio创建桶名称,提示报错。不要使用中文命名,命名的时候可以在mysql中设置映射表,作用为中文名称和桶名称的映射。假如桶数量少的话也可以使用静态常量或者枚举。2、问题原因以下规则适用于在AmazonS3中命名存储桶:存储桶名称的长度必须介于3到63个字符之间。存储桶名称只能由小写字母、数字、点(.)和连字符(-)组成。存储桶名称必须以字母或数字开头和结尾。存储桶名称不得格式化为IP地址(例如,192.168.5.4)。存储桶名称不得以前缀开头xn–。存储桶名称不得以后缀结尾-s3alias。此后缀是为接入点别名保留的。有关更多信息,请参阅为访问点使用存储桶样式的别名。存储
1、实战问题POST test-002/_bulk{"index":{"_id":1}}{"name": "张三","city": "beijing"}{"index":{"_id":2}}{"name": "李四","city": "beijing"}{"index":{"_id":3}}{"name": "王五","city": "shanghai"}{"index":{"_id":4}}{"name": "赵六","city": "shanghai"}请教老师,上面的是我在es保存的数据,想写一个dsl,求出来beijing占比50%,shanghai占比50%。死磕Elasticsea
1、实战问题POST test-002/_bulk{"index":{"_id":1}}{"name": "张三","city": "beijing"}{"index":{"_id":2}}{"name": "李四","city": "beijing"}{"index":{"_id":3}}{"name": "王五","city": "shanghai"}{"index":{"_id":4}}{"name": "赵六","city": "shanghai"}请教老师,上面的是我在es保存的数据,想写一个dsl,求出来beijing占比50%,shanghai占比50%。死磕Elasticsea
准备工作创建Bucket标准存储在RAM访问控制中创建用户保存AccessKeyID和AccessKeySecret (重要,bucket创建完成后才能显示且仅此一次)设置权限AliyunOSSFullAccessjava实现用户头像的上传依赖引入com.aliyun.ossaliyun-sdk-oss3.10.2application.yml配置#----------阿里云OSS配置--------------aliyun:oss:endpoint:[Endpoint(地域节点)——外网访问]access-key-id:[AccessKeyID]access-key-secret:[Acce
谁能告诉我如何确定某个文件/对象是否存在于S3存储桶中,并在存在或不存在时显示消息。基本上我希望它:1)检查我的S3帐户上的存储桶,例如testbucket2)在该桶内,查看是否有前缀为test_的文件(test_file.txt或test_data.txt)。3)如果该文件存在,则显示该文件存在或该文件不存在的MessageBox(或控制台消息)。有人可以告诉我怎么做吗? 最佳答案 使用适用于.Net的AWSSDK我目前正在做一些事情:publicboolExists(stringfileKey,stringbucketName)
谁能告诉我如何确定某个文件/对象是否存在于S3存储桶中,并在存在或不存在时显示消息。基本上我希望它:1)检查我的S3帐户上的存储桶,例如testbucket2)在该桶内,查看是否有前缀为test_的文件(test_file.txt或test_data.txt)。3)如果该文件存在,则显示该文件存在或该文件不存在的MessageBox(或控制台消息)。有人可以告诉我怎么做吗? 最佳答案 使用适用于.Net的AWSSDK我目前正在做一些事情:publicboolExists(stringfileKey,stringbucketName)
对象存储OSS阿里云对象存储OSS(ObjectStorageService)是一款海量、安全、低成本、高可靠的云存储服务,提供99.9999999999%(12个9)的数据持久性,99.995%的数据可用性。多种存储类型供选择,全面优化存储成本。劫持利用访问某域名,提示NoSuchBucket获取信息,这个桶不存在HostId: baobao-tb.oss-cn-shenzhen.aliyuncs.comBucketName: baobao-tb登陆阿里云,访问(OSS管理控制台)[https://oss.console.aliyun.com/overview]创建Bucket注意填写Buc
因此,我试图从TensorFlow中使用tf.bucket_by_secorence_length(),但无法完全弄清楚如何使其工作。基本上,它应将(不同长度)的序列作为输入,并将序列列为输出,但似乎没有用这种方式工作。从这个讨论中:https://github.com/tensorflow/tensorflow/issues/5609我的印象是,它需要队列才能按顺序为序列提供此功能。尚不清楚。函数的文档可以在此处找到:https://www.tensorflow.org/versions/r0.12/api_docs/python/contrib.training/bucketing#buc
我打算使用Prometheus直方图向量来监控Go中请求处理程序的执行时间。我这样注册:varRequestTimeHistogramVec=prometheus.NewHistogramVec(prometheus.HistogramOpts{Name:"request_duration_seconds",Help:"Requestdurationdistribution",Buckets:[]float64{0.125,0.25,0.5,1,1.5,2,3,4,5,7.5,10,20},},[]string{"endpoint"},)funcinit(){prometheus.Mu